浏览器文本替换插件

这里写自定义目录标题

代码部分


function replace_str() {
    var ele_name_list = ["title", "span", "input", "a"]
    var codeEnum = {
        "408": "测试",
        "考研": "工程师",
        "王道": "入门",
        "计算机组成原理": "测试原理",
        "操作系统": "测试框架",
        "数据结构": "测试结构",
        "计算机网络": "网络测试",
    };
    var ele_list = []

    console.log(ele_name_list)
    ele_name_list.forEach(ele => {
        var label = document.querySelectorAll(ele);

        label.forEach(element => {
            ele_list.push(element)
        });
    })
    

    console.log(ele_list)
    ele_list.forEach((ele, _, __) => {
        // console.log(ele.innerHTML)
        // ele.innerHTML = "******"
        for (var code in codeEnum) {
            var msg = codeEnum[code];
            // ele.innerHTML = "*********"
            if (true || ele.innerHTML.indexOf(code) >= 0) {
                var target = String(ele.innerHTML).replace(code, msg);
                console.log(target);
                ele.innerHTML = target;
            }
        }

    })
    console.log("替换完成")
}
setTimeout(function () {
    replace_str()
}, 500)


评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值